i use miteexpr or gx to extract the dds files.  photoshop with plugin to edit dds.  then reinject.

okay, say i am editing a outfit and i took some material off to make it shorter, but when I reinject and try it out, the material I took off is still there just shown in black. what can I do to fix that?

you need bossafs... with that you can add transparency to the dxt1 files... normally only dxt4 have transparency flags

shoot im a bit rusty.. so forgive me if im incorrect.
to give the dds file transparency
select the dds file desired
click both transparency flags
and press apply
then extract

I think that you also must change the resolution of the DDS file, in order to add transparency.  So, if you add transparency to a 256x256 DDS file, you need to reduce one of the dimensions by 1/2.  Meaning the resulting DDS would be 256x128.
